      In the world of banking and business, audits play a crucial role in maintaining financial transparency and regulatory compliance. While routine audits examine overall financial health, a **special audit** is different.       Investment appraisal methods are techniques used to evaluate investment proposals and assist companies in determining their desirability based on their income-generating potential. These methods also help rank proposals in order of preference. A sound appraisal method should enable the company to measure the real worth of a proposal and make informed accept-or-reject decisions.
